In today’s fast-paced business environment, organizations are constantly seeking ways to enhance efficiency, reduce costs, and improve productivity. One technology that has emerged as a game-changer in this regard is Robotic Process Automation (RPA). In this comprehensive guide, we’ll explore what RPA is, how it works, its benefits and challenges, real-world use cases, and tips for getting started with RPA implementation.
What is RPA?
Robotic Process Automation (RPA) is a technology that allows businesses to automate repetitive, rules-based tasks by deploying software robots or “bots” to perform them. Unlike traditional automation solutions, which typically require extensive coding and integration efforts, RPA enables organizations to automate processes quickly and cost-effectively using a graphical user interface (GUI) to configure bots.
How Does RPA Work?
At its core, RPA mimics human actions to interact with digital systems and applications. Bots are trained to perform tasks such as data entry, copy-pasting information between systems, filling out forms, and processing transactions. RPA tools provide a visual interface for designing automation workflows, defining triggers and conditions, and orchestrating bot activities.
Benefits of RPA:
The adoption of RPA offers numerous benefits to organizations, including:
- Increased Productivity: Bots can work 24/7 without breaks or errors, leading to significant productivity gains.
- Cost Savings: By automating repetitive tasks, organizations can reduce labor costs and reallocate resources to higher-value activities.
- Improved Accuracy: RPA eliminates human errors associated with manual data entry and processing, resulting in higher accuracy and compliance.
- Enhanced Scalability: RPA enables organizations to scale automation efforts rapidly to meet growing business demands.
- Faster Time-to-Value: With RPA, organizations can achieve rapid returns on investment (ROI) by automating processes in weeks rather than months.
Use Cases:
RPA can be applied across various industries and functional areas, including:
- Finance and Accounting: Automating invoice processing, accounts payable/receivable, financial reporting, and reconciliation.
- Human Resources: Streamlining employee onboarding, payroll processing, leave management, and compliance reporting.
- Customer Service: Automating customer inquiries, order processing, refunds, and case management.
- Supply Chain Management: Optimizing inventory management, order fulfillment, shipping, and supplier management.
- Healthcare: Automating claims processing, patient registration, appointment scheduling, and medical record management.
Challenges and Considerations:
While RPA offers numerous benefits, organizations should be aware of potential challenges and considerations, including:
- Complexity of Processes: Some processes may be too complex or variable to be effectively automated with RPA.
- Integration with Legacy Systems: RPA implementation may require integration with existing legacy systems, which can be challenging and time-consuming.
- Security and Compliance: Organizations must ensure that RPA implementations comply with data privacy regulations and security best practices.
- Change Management: Employee resistance and cultural barriers may hinder the adoption of RPA within organizations, requiring effective change management strategies.
Future Trends in RPA:
The future of RPA is characterized by several emerging trends and innovations, including:
- Intelligent Automation: Combining RPA with artificial intelligence (AI) and machine learning (ML) capabilities to enable cognitive automation and decision-making.
- Hyperautomation: Extending automation beyond RPA to include complementary technologies such as process mining, natural language processing (NLP), and predictive analytics.
- Cloud-based RPA: Leveraging cloud platforms to provide scalable, flexible, and cost-effective RPA solutions.
- Automation-as-a-Service: Offering RPA capabilities as a service, enabling organizations to access automation tools and expertise without heavy upfront investments.
Getting Started with RPA:
To embark on an RPA journey, organizations should follow these key steps:
- Assess Automation Potential: Identify and prioritize processes suitable for automation based on criteria such as volume, frequency, and complexity.
- Select RPA Tools: Evaluate and select RPA tools that align with your organization’s requirements, budget, and scalability needs.
- Design Automation Workflows: Use RPA tools to design, build, and test automation workflows, ensuring they meet business objectives and compliance standards.
- Deploy Bots: Deploy bots to production environments and monitor their performance, making adjustments as needed to optimize efficiency and accuracy.
- Train Employees: Provide training and support to employees impacted by RPA implementations, emphasizing the benefits and opportunities for upskilling.
- Continuously Improve: Regularly assess and refine automation workflows based on feedback, performance metrics, and changes in business requirements.
Conclusion:
Robotic Process Automation (RPA) has emerged as a transformative technology that enables organizations to streamline operations, enhance productivity, and drive innovation. By automating repetitive, rules-based tasks, RPA frees up human resources to focus on more strategic activities, ultimately driving business growth and competitive advantage. As organizations continue to embrace digital transformation, RPA will play an increasingly vital role in shaping the future of work.
Good content
Thanks Arnav for kind words